Transaction 3723914498c02d4ce7310929781df499ab15253617917bb186f51da0c3649303
1 Input
1 Output
-
3723914498c02d4ce7310929781df499ab15253617917bb186f51da0c3649303:0
- value
- 683474
- script pubkey
- OP_0 OP_PUSHBYTES_20 10a74864efc7c9d1a1c6eb50a0053db36ef71746
- address
- bc1qzzn5se80clyargwxadg2qpfakdh0w96xvc9vka